Skip to main content
Se proporciona el idioma español mediante traducción automática para su comodidad. En caso de alguna inconsistencia, el inglés precede al español.

Restaurar parte de un archivo a partir de una instantánea de ONTAP

Colaboradores

Puede utilizar volume snapshot partial-restore-file el comando para restaurar un rango de datos desde una snapshot a una LUN o a un archivo de contenedor NFS o SMB, suponiendo que se conoce el desplazamiento de bytes de inicio de los datos y el número de bytes. Este comando puede usarse para restaurar una de las bases de datos en un host que almacena varias bases de datos en el mismo LUN.

A partir de ONTAP 9.12.1, está disponible la restauración parcial para los volúmenes que usan SnapMirror síncrono activo.

Pasos
  1. Enumere las snapshots en un volumen:

    volume snapshot show -vserver SVM -volume volume

    Obtenga más información sobre volume snapshot show en el "Referencia de comandos del ONTAP".

    En el siguiente ejemplo se muestran las instantáneas en vol1:

    clus1::> volume snapshot show -vserver vs1 -volume vol1
    
    Vserver Volume Snapshot                State    Size  Total% Used%
    ------- ------ ---------- ----------- ------   -----  ------ -----
    vs1	    vol1   hourly.2013-01-25_0005  valid   224KB     0%    0%
                   daily.2013-01-25_0010   valid   92KB      0%    0%
                   hourly.2013-01-25_0105  valid   228KB     0%    0%
                   hourly.2013-01-25_0205  valid   236KB     0%    0%
                   hourly.2013-01-25_0305  valid   244KB     0%    0%
                   hourly.2013-01-25_0405  valid   244KB     0%    0%
                   hourly.2013-01-25_0505  valid   244KB     0%    0%
    
    7 entries were displayed.
  2. Restaurar parte de un archivo a partir de una instantánea:

    volume snapshot partial-restore-file -vserver SVM -volume volume -snapshot snapshot -path file_path -start-byte starting_byte -byte-count byte_count

    El desplazamiento de bytes de inicio y el número de bytes deben ser múltiplos de 4,096.

    El siguiente ejemplo restaura los primeros 4.096 bytes del archivo myfile.txt:

    cluster1::> volume snapshot partial-restore-file -vserver vs0 -volume vol1 -snapshot daily.2013-01-25_0010 -path /myfile.txt -start-byte 0 -byte-count 4096